Description

(From the preface)This book was initiated by the architecture -facultyof the University of Moscow in the late fifties. For theItalian edition in 1968 the material was enlarged andrevised by the authors, a group of young urbanists,architects, and sociologists, who represent a renewalof ideas and men that is taking place in Soviet Russia,especially in fields concerned with the organizationof the physical environment. Their work is particularlyoriginal in its general assumptions, method of inquiry,and choice of models. The authors turn away from theproposition that the city should attempt to restorethe habits and appearance of the countryside. Thisproposition adapted from the bourgeois naturalismof the nineteenth century, contradicted the ideological foundations of communism. By contrast, what isproposed in this book is world-wide urbanization. Theauthors design concept, the New Unit of Settlement,incorporates countryside with city, conceiving bothas a communication network, uniformly intense anddiffused.
